The following definitions apply to educational advisory bodies created by this chapter:

(a)An “educational policy advisory commission” is an advisory body to the state board composed of professional and lay members, as defined by this code. These groups are established to advise the state board within the general policy areas to which they are charged. The Superintendent or the Superintendent’s representative shall serve as executive secretary to each educational policy advisory commission.
